ITEM 5.  OTHER EVENTS

On September 13, 2000, the United States Bankruptcy Court for the District of
Delaware issued its final order permitting Coram Healthcare Corporation and
Coram, Inc., collectively referred to as the "company," to access, as necessary,
the previously negotiated Debtor-in-Possession (DIP) financing agreement with
Madeleine L.L.C., an affiliate of one of the company's principal debt holders.
The financing agreement, dated August 30, 2000, provides the company with access
to a DIP financing line of credit of up to $40 million. A copy of the related
September 13, 2000 press release is attached hereto as Exhibit 99.1.
